Wild Introduce Parise, Suter at Press Conference
Wild Introduce Parise, Suter at Press Conference
Wild Introduce Parise, Suter at Press Conference
The Minnesota Wild officially welcomed free agent signees Zach Parise and Ryan Suter at a press conference at the Xcel Energy Center in St. Paul Monday. Parise and Suter both signed 13-year $98 Million contracts. Parise said at the press conference that both he and Suter wanted to be here and that it all came together as they talked about the possibility Monday and Tuesday of last week. Both agreed to contracts on Wednesday July 4.

Wild Sign Parise, Suter To 13-Year Contracts
Wild Sign Parise, Suter To 13-Year Contracts
Wild Sign Parise, Suter To 13-Year Contracts
The Minnesota Wild signed the top two available NHL free agents left wing Zach Parise and defenseman Ryan Suter to 13-year $98 Million contracts on Wednesday. Parise and Suter are both 27-years old and have Minnesota ties. Parise grew up in Minnesota, played high school hockey at Shattuck St. Mary's in Faribault, college hockey at North Dakota and is the son of former Minnesota North Star J.P. Parise. Suter's wife is from Bloomington, Minnesota.
Parise, Suter Decision Could Come Today
Parise, Suter Decision Could Come Today
Parise, Suter Decision Could Come Today
The Minnesota Wild could find out today according to sources whether they will land top free agents Zach Parise and Ryan Suter. Parise arrived in Minnesota yesterday to talk over his decision with his family but indicated to the Star Tribune that him being here didn't necessarily indicate that he would sign with the Wild. The Wild visited Suter in Madison, Wisconsin Tuesday but so did Detroit.
Wild Sign Konopka and Mitchell; Continue Pursuit of Parise, Suter
Wild Sign Konopka and Mitchell; Continue Pursuit of Parise, Suter
Wild Sign Konopka and Mitchell; Continue Pursuit of Parise, Suter
The Minnesota continue to pursue free agent left wing Zach Parise and defenseman Ryan Suter but announced the signing of free agent center Zenon Konopka from Ottawa and center/right wing Torry Mitchell from San Jose. Konopka signs a 2-year deal worth $925,000 per season and Mitchell signs a 3-year contract worth $1.9 Million a season.
